The elixir-ls team have said that for sourceror to be used in elixir-ls they "need it vendored like dialyxir and jason".

When I checked, this means that the elixir-ls uses a dep branch that has all Dialyxir modules renamed to DialyxirVendored.

Would you consider creating a fork of sourceror e.g. elixir-lsp/sourceror that mirrors the latest sourceror release with all Sourceror modules renamed to VendoredSourceror?
